1 vs 10: Completion Thinking and Authorship Thinking

There are two ways people interpret 2026 through numerology, and they lead to very different behaviors.

The first is completion thinking, which centers on the number 10. Numerologically, 10 represents completion and compression. It is the point where experience, lessons, and cycles collapse into clarity. In Chinese cosmology, this mirrors the idea of a cycle fully exhausting itself before energy can reorganize. This lens emphasizes reflection, integration, and understanding what has already occurred.

The second is authorship thinking, which centers on the number 1. One carries a different function. One is forward identity. It is the point where direction matters more than analysis. A Universal 1 year does not focus on processing what ended. It asks for consistency from what has already been decided and lived.

The confusion happens when completion thinking is applied to a year that requires authorship. When people over-emphasize 10 in a Universal 1 cycle, they tend to linger in reflection, explanation, or meaning-making, instead of moving forward from a settled identity.

Completion already happened. What matters now is direction.

Why 2026 Is Different

2026 opens a Universal 1 cycle, but it is shaped by specific energetic conditions. The Wood element governs sustainability, organic growth, and systems that compound rather than spike. In feng shui and Five Element theory, wood does not grow through force. It grows because it is aligned with light, space, and direction. Growth in this cycle favors what is already coherent rather than what is aggressively pushed.

The Horse adds momentum. Horse energy does not wait for certainty or permission. It clarifies truth through motion. In Chinese astrology, the horse represents freedom, travel, speed, and uncontained forward movement. It does not move in circles. It moves outward, revealing what can sustain pace and what falls away under movement.

Together, this creates a year where identity stabilizes through what continues to move forward without strain. What cannot move consistently will feel heavy. What is aligned will begin to carry itself.
